Ravioli is a delicious Italian pasta, “relatives” of our favorite dumplings. They cook with various fillings. Try to cook them at home with mushrooms. For juiciness, add greens and a little broth.

Steps
Steps taken: 0/0
- Sift flour into a bowl. Drive eggs. Add half a teaspoon salt and one tablespoon of olive oil. Knead the dough. At need to add a little warm water. Cover the dough and give stand for 30 minutes.
- Cut the champignons into slices.
- Finely chop the parsley.
- Chop onions and garlic.
- Fry onions and garlic in a pan in olive oil.
- Add mushrooms. Fry for another 5 minutes.
- Pour in chicken (vegetable) broth. Salt and pepper on to taste. Put in the oven, preheated to 200 degrees for 30 minutes. Every 10 minutes, stir the mushrooms.
- Remove the mushrooms from the oven. Cool a little. Some mushrooms leave to serve in plates, grind the rest in a blender for toppings. Add chopped parsley. Pour a tablespoon olive oil. Stir the mushroom mass until smooth.
- Knead the dough again and roll into thin layers. On one layer with a teaspoon, lay out the filling with balls on the same distance from each other. Cover the top with a second layer. Stick together ravioli, taking the dough around the filling. Cut ravioli curly or an ordinary knife or a special cookie cutter.
- Boil ravioli in salted water. When serving garnish with mushrooms.
